In SearchFiles.py, when you run a query, you get:
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"SearchFiles.py", line 37, in ?
run(searcher, analyzer)
File "SearchFiles.py", line 24, in run
query = QueryParser.parse(command, "contents", analyzer)
TypeError: descriptor 'parse' requires a 'PyLucene.QueryParser' object but
received a 'str'
Looks like it expects an instance of PyLucene.QueryParser?
Yes, that is a left over from pre-2.0 APIs. Line 24 should say:
query = QueryParser("contents", analyzer).parse(command)
